Unity--视觉组件(Raw Image,Mask)||Unity--视觉组件(Text,Image)

1.Raw Image

2.mask

“”Raw Image:“”

Texture:(纹理)

表示要显示的图像的纹理;

Color:(颜色)

应用于图像的颜色;

Material:(材质)

用于渲染图像的材质;

Raycast Target:(射线)

如果希望Unity将图像视为 光线投射的目标,启用 光线投射目标;

UV Rect:(UV)

图像在控制矩形内的偏移量和大小,以标准化坐标(范围为0.0到1.0)给出。图像的边缘被拉伸以填充UV矩形周围的空间;

由于原始图像不需要精灵纹理,因此可以使用它显示Unity播放器可用的任何纹理。例如,可能会显示使用 WWW类从URL下载的图像或游戏对象的纹理

“”mask:“”

遮罩将子元素限制(即“”遮罩“”)为父元素的形状。

Mask

Show Mask Graphic:(显示图形)

遮罩(父)对象的图形是否对应在子对象上绘制Alpha?

遮罩的常见用法是显示大型图像的一小部分,例如使用Panel对象(菜单: GameObject> Create UI> Panel)作为“框架”。可以通过首先将Image作为Panel对象的子级来实现。应该放置图像的位置,以使应显示的区域直接位于“面板”区域的后面。

 

1.Text(文本)

2.Image(图像)

“视觉组件(Text,Image)”

随着UI系统的引入,已添加了新组件,这些组件将帮助您创建特定于GUI的功能。本节将介绍可以创建的新组件的基础。

“Text”:

Text

该组件为“文本”,具有用于输入将要显示的文本区域,可以设置字体,字体样式,字体大小以及文本是都具有富文本的功能
有一些选项可用于设置文本的对齐方式,用于水平和垂直溢出的设置(可控制如果文本大于矩形的宽度或高度时会发生什么)以及“最佳适合”选项,该选项可使文本调整大小以适合可用空间

Characater

Font:

字体格式;

Font Style:

Normal(默认),Bold(粗体),Italic(斜体),BoldAndItalic(粗体和斜体);

Font Size:

字体的大小;

Line Spacing :

文本中的行与行之间的间隔;

Rich Text:

是否使用富文本;

Paragraph

Alignment:

文本的排版: 左对齐,居中,右对齐
左上对齐,居中,右下对齐

Align By Geometry:

几何对齐;

Horizontal Overflow:

水平溢出:溢出,隐藏溢出;

Vertical Overflow:

垂直溢出:溢出,截断溢出;

Best Fit:

最佳适配:设置最大和最小值;

Color:

设置字体的颜色;

Material:

设置字体的材质;

Raycast Target:

是否可点击;

“Image”

Source Image:

设置并且填充需要设置的图像;

Color:

设置图像的颜色;

Material:

设置图像的材质;

Raycast Target:

是否可点击;

Preserve Aspect:

是否保护;

图像具有Rect Transform组件和 Image组件。可以将“精灵”应用于“目标图形”字段下的“图像”组件,并可以在“颜色”字段中设置其颜色。材质也可以应用于“图像”组件。图像类型字段定义了所应用的精灵的显示方式,选项包括:

简单 -均匀缩放整个精灵。

切片 -利用3x3精灵分割,以便调整大小不会使拐角变形,而仅拉伸中心部分。

平铺 -与“切片”相似,但平铺(重复)中心部分而不是拉伸它。对于完全没有边界的精灵,将整个精灵平铺。

填充 -以与Simple相同的方式显示子画面,不同之处在于它从原点按照定义的方向,方法和数量填充子画面。

选择“简单”或“填充”时显示的“设置本机大小”选项将图像重置为原始精灵大小。
通过从“纹理类型”设置中选择Sprite(2D / UI),可以将图像作为 UI精灵导入。与旧的GUI Sprite相比,Sprite具有额外的导入设置,最大的不同是增加了Sprite编辑器。Sprite编辑器提供了对图像进行 9切片的选项,这会将图像分为9个区域,因此,如果调整Sprite的大小,则不会拉伸或扭曲拐角

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/169457.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

AlGaN/GaN HFET 五参数模型

标题:A Five-Parameter Model of the AlGaN/GaN HFET 来源:IEEE TRANSACTIONS ON ELECTRON DEVICES(15年) 摘要—我们引入了AlGaN/GaN异质结场效应晶体管(HFET)漏极电流Id(Vgs,Vds…

第四节(2):修改WORD中表格数据的方案

《VBA信息获取与处理》教程(10178984)是我推出第六套教程,目前已经是第一版修订了。这套教程定位于最高级,是学完初级,中级后的教程。这部教程给大家讲解的内容有:跨应用程序信息获得、随机信息的利用、电子邮件的发送、VBA互联网…

自适应AI chatGPT智能聊天创作官网html源码/最新AI创作系统/ChatGPT商业版网站源码

源码简介: 自适应AI chatGPT智能聊天创作官网html源码,这是最新AI创作系统,作为ChatGPT商业版网站源码,它是支持创作、编写、翻译、写代码等。是一个智能聊天系统项目源码。 注意:这个只是网站html源码,要…

MongoDB基础知识~

引入MongoDB: 在面对高并发,高效率存储和访问,高扩展性和高可用性等的需求下,我们之前所学习过的关系型数据库(MySql,sql server…)显得有点力不从心,而这些需求在我们的生活中也是随处可见的,例如在社交中…

基于Matlab+ AlexNet神经网络的动物识别系统

欢迎大家点赞、收藏、关注、评论啦 ,由于篇幅有限,只展示了部分核心代码。 文章目录 一项目简介 二、功能三、系统四. 总结 一项目简介 基于Matlab和AlexNet神经网络的动物识别系统可以用于自然图像识别等场景,以下是一个基本的介绍设计步骤…

Linux每日智囊

每日分享三个Linux命令,悄悄培养读者的Linux技能。 whatis 作用 查询指定命令的功能,将结果显示在终端上 语法 whatis 命令 案例 查询指定命令的功能 whatis sleeptouch 作用 修改已有文件的时间戳 (不常用)创建新的空文件 (常用) 语法 touc…

物联网水表电子阀工作原理是怎样的?

随着科技的不断发展,物联网技术逐渐深入到我们的生活之中。作为智能家居的重要组成部分,物联网水表电子阀凭借其智能化、节能环保等优势,受到了越来越多用户的青睐。接下来,合众小编将来为大家介绍下物联网水表电子阀工作原理。 一…

docker部署es+kibana

es 暴露的端口特别多 ,十分耗内存,数据一般要放置到安全目录,挂载 官网推荐的命令:docker run -d --name elasticsearch --net somenetwork -p 9200:9200 -p 9300:9300 -e "discovery.typesingle-node" elasticsearch…

基于SSM的考研图书电子商务平台的设计与实现

末尾获取源码 开发语言:Java Java开发工具:JDK1.8 后端框架:SSM 前端:Vue 数据库:MySQL5.7和Navicat管理工具结合 服务器:Tomcat8.5 开发软件:IDEA / Eclipse 是否Maven项目:是 目录…

【Redis】String字符串类型

上一篇:Redis-key的使用 https://blog.csdn.net/m0_67930426/article/details/134361821?spm1001 .2014.3001.5501 目录 appen (附加) strlen(获取字符串的长度) incr decr getRange(获取字符串) setRange(替…

GCC工具详解【Linux知识贩卖机】

很多人在喧嚣声中登场,也有少数人在静默中退出。 --单独中的洞见2 文章目录 简介程序到可执行文件链接动态链接和静态链接动态库和静态库动态库和静态库的打包打包静态库打包动态库选项 -static 总结 简介 GCC(GNU Compiler Collection) 是一…

思科9300交换机使用USB进行升级ISO

一、下载ISO 一、网址 Software Download - Cisco Systems 二、找到型号 四、选择XE 软件 五、进行下载 二、COPY 进 U盘 一、、请注意!如果你的U盘不是Fat32文件格式则交换机读取不了,请先格式化再复制文件。 二、下载后将 bin文件复制到U盘。 1.扩展…